Match Preview & Form Guide

The upcoming Serie B clash at the Mapei Stadium on April 12, 2026, presents a desperate situation for Reggiana. Currently sitting in 20th place and facing the stark reality of relegation, the home side is in woeful form, registering a 1-3 loss against Pescara in their last outing and managing only a single point from their last five league fixtures. Under the relatively new stewardship of manager Pierpaolo Bisoli—appointed in late March 2026—the team is struggling to find both defensive stability and an attacking spark.

Conversely, Carrarese, managed by Nicola Antonio Calabro, occupies a comfortable 9th position and enters this match with significantly more momentum. After a solid 3-1 victory over Spezia, Carrarese has proven to be a difficult side to beat in recent weeks. While they remain an "average" team by statistical metrics, their ability to grind out results gives them a distinct psychological advantage over a Reggiana side that has lost 17 of their 33 matches this season.

Key Context:

  • Reggiana Absences: Alessandro Tripaldelli (suspended), Paolo Rozzio (injured), and Andrea Bozzolan (injured).
  • Carrarese Absences: Niccolò Belloni (suspended).
  • Historical Trend: Remarkably, the last five head-to-head matches between these two sides have ended in draws, highlighting a parity that often masks current form differences.

Tactical Analysis & Key Battles

Manager Pierpaolo Bisoli is known for tactical discipline, and he will likely task Reggiana with sitting deep to absorb pressure, hoping to exploit transition moments. However, their leaky defense has struggled against organized attacks all season. Carrarese will aim to dictate the tempo and likely look to bypass the midfield quickly to isolate Reggiana’s center-backs.

Key Battle: The matchup between Carrarese’s top scorer, Fabio Abiuso (11 goals), and the Reggiana defense will be the decisive factor. If Reggiana’s backline cannot contain Abiuso’s movement in the box, their prospects for a home win are minimal. Conversely, Reggiana must rely on Manolo Portanova to create something out of nothing, as their attacking production has been insufficient to outscore opponents.
